This repo gathers smaller-scale tools and demos related to systems programming and infrastructure. Topics include low-level I/O, process and signal management, access control, backup automation, and environment tooling.
All included projects are tracked as Git submodules and live inside the projects/ directory. This allows each tool to remain independently versioned while making them easy to explore as a group. See below for cloning instructions if you're unfamiliar with Git submodules.
| Submodule | Description |
|---|---|
assembly-io |
MASM-based 32-bit Windows program for low-level integer I/O and mean calculation. Demonstrates the verbosity and intricacy of even basic tasks in Assembly. |
smallsh |
A lightweight Linux shell written in C. Supports job control, I/O redirection, and foreground/background process management. |
pygetfacl |
Python wrapper for the Linux getfacl command. Converts ACL information into structured Python objects for programmatic access. |
btrfs-restic |
Backup tool that snapshots BTRFS subvolumes and sends them to a remote Restic repository. Emphasizes snapshot-based consistency and simple, secure remote storage. |
convertpytoml |
Command-line utility to convert pyproject.toml files between pip-style and Poetry-style formats. Helps smooth workflow transitions between packaging tools. |
This repository uses Git submodules. To clone it with all nested projects included:
git clone --recurse-submodules https://github.com/duanegoodner/systems-workshop.gitIf you’ve already cloned the repo and need to initialize the submodules afterward:
git submodule update --init --recursive
